The Goal: Capture the lecturer's ideas as accurately and fully as possible in the order the ideas are delivered, to allow for analyzing, reflecting and making them your own. The Reason: To make a record of the lecture to fill the gaps created by the massive forgetting that will take place during and after the lecture. "Taking notes " on one lecture with 25 slides ... WebSep 1, 2024 · You can test yourself organically as part of your reading and note-taking by using the 3R approach. This involves reading a short passage of text, putting the source to one side and trying to recall the information in your own words then checking your recall against the text for factual accuracy.
